What we found

Level 1 · assistive

This workflow carries a mandated human checkpoint — filing a suspicious activity report is a human determination under the Bank Secrecy Act. Held at the rubric default because every source reviewed so far is vendor-published, and a grade above assistive needs something independent behind it.

The human checkpoint here is imposed by regulation — it is not a setting that can be turned off.
